Description
The position of Assistant Coach is done for the purpose/s of assisting the head coach in designing and implementing the athletic program for assigned sport(s) in accordance with applicable rules and regulations; assist with conducting practices, motivating students, and instructing student athletes in game strategies and techniques.
Essential Functions:
- Assists the Head coach with instructing players in the rules, regulations, equipment, and techniques of the sport.
- Organizes and directs individual and small group practice activities/exercises as directed by the Head coach.
- Assesses player’s skills, monitors players during competition and practice, and keeps the Head coach informed of the athletic performance of students.
- Assists with determining game strategy.
- Assists the Head coach with supervising athletes during practices and competition.
- Follows established procedures in the event of an athlete’s injury.
- Models sports-like behavior and maintains appropriate conduct towards players, officials, and spectators.
- Distributes equipment, supplies, and uniforms to students as directed by the Head coach.
